Gyan Jyoti Public School is affiliated with the Uttar Pradesh Madhyamik Shiksha Parishad (U.P. Board), offering education as per the guidelines of the state education board.
The school offers education from Nursery to Class 12, with subject options available in Science, Commerce, and Arts streams at the senior secondary level.
Facilities include well-equipped classrooms, science labs, a computer lab, library, sports ground, and digital learning aids to support modern education.
Yes, the school provides safe and convenient bus transportation for students, covering nearby areas. Each vehicle is supervised by trained staff.
Admission is based on availability of seats, submission of required documents, and an interaction or entrance test (depending on the class). Forms are available at the school office.
- The school emphasizes all-round development through sports, cultural programs, debate, art & craft, music, and other club activities.
Yes, the school provides merit-based scholarships and concessions for economically weaker sections, as per school policy and availability.
- School hours are generally 8:00 AM to 2:00 PM, Monday to Saturday. Timings may vary slightly for junior sections or during special events.
